Test plan for the Hollowmere catalogue import. We validate MARC record ingestion against the Bexley staging instance, checking duplicate detection, diacritic handling, and shelf-location mapping. Each run must authenticate against the import API before uploading batches, and future maintainers should note that tokens are environment-specific. For staging runs, use the bearer token provided below.

session JWT of yawep-yawep = eyJhbGciOiJIUzI1NiIsInR5cCI6IkpXVCJ9.eyJzdWIiOiI3pWF3_In0.aXYsHiog

Minutes — Management Meeting, Dalberry House

Attendees: branch managers, regional leads.

The Corvex reseller programme was reviewed. Margins remain at agreed tiers; onboarding of three new partners in the Westmoor region is on schedule. Branch managers to submit partner performance reports by month end. Marketing collateral ships next week. Strategic context for the programme follows below.

confidential, kagep-kahof: Druokax Systems plans to lower the Ulaath list price by 53 percent in March.

Heads up, plugin folks: we changed some defaults in the garage occupancy feed. Polling interval drops from 60s to 20s, because the Kervalle Centre garage fills fast at lunch and everyone's dashboards looked stale. Stale-reading tolerance is now 90 seconds, and readings older than that get flagged rather than silently served. If your plugin assumed the old cadence, double-check your caching. We also renamed two keys — old names still work until v5, with deprecation warnings. The new default configuration is shown below.

deployment values, tafog-kagap:
wenath:
  pin: 4244
  metrics_host: metrics.wenath.lumicsys.internal
  tenant: istix
  seal: seal_10585894

☐ Step 6 — Offline-mode keys for Surveyor (Fenwick Field App). Confirm the offline sync bundle was generated on the air-gapped laptop and that two custodians initialed the log. On-call: if sync fails in the field, devices fall back to cached maps only. After witness sign-off, record the recovery passphrase, which appears below.

strongbox words: sorir-belvan-rusix-ulays-ralmir-praix-eliir-tamax-praael-druael-julir-tamius-jorir